How Electric Drum Brakes Work


Electric drum brakes operate on a principle similar to that of traditional drum brakes. When the driver presses the brake pedal, the brake controller sends an electrical signal to the brake actuator, which is typically mounted inside the drum. This actuator, often in the form of an electromagnet, engages the brake shoes against the inside of the drum when current flows through it, generating a magnetic field. The ensuing friction between the shoes and the drum surface slows the wheel down, thereby stopping the vehicle.


One of the remarkable features of electric drum brakes is their ability to adjust the braking force effectively. The brake controller can regulate the power supplied to the actuator, allowing for a proportionate response depending on various factors such as vehicle load, speed, and braking conditions. This responsive nature not only enhances safety but also extends the lifespan of the braking components by minimizing wear while ensuring consistent brake performance.


Advantages of Electric Drum Brakes


1. Simplicity and Reliability Electric drum brakes have fewer moving parts compared to hydraulic systems, which often translate to reduced maintenance and increased reliability. As there are no hydraulic fluids involved, the risk of leaks is significantly diminished, leading to enhanced durability.


2. Stronger Braking Force The electric design allows for a more robust braking application compared to traditional systems. This is particularly beneficial for heavier vehicles like trailers, where stopping effectively is critical.


3. Enhanced Control Electric drum brakes allow for better control over braking. The ability to adjust braking force electronically means that the driver can experience smoother engagements, reducing the likelihood of wheel lock-up and skidding.

4. Integration with Advanced Systems Electric drum brakes can be easily integrated with modern vehicle technologies such as anti-lock braking systems (ABS) and electronic stability control (ESC). These integrations provide a comprehensive safety net for drivers, employing various sensors to determine how much braking force is necessary in different conditions.


5. Energy Efficiency For electric vehicles, electric drum brakes offer an additional benefit by recuperating energy during braking. By using regenerative braking systems in conjunction with electric drum brakes, vehicles can convert kinetic energy back into stored electrical energy, enhancing overall efficiency.


Applications of Electric Drum Brakes


The versatility of electric drum brakes enables their utilization in numerous applications. Their primary use is in trailers, including those used for towing boats, campers, and heavy cargo. The braking system's ability to provide a secure and reliable stopping force makes it ideal for such scenarios where the weight and dynamics of additional loads can significantly vary.


In addition to trailers, many electric and hybrid vehicles now employ electric drum brakes in part of their braking systems. This shift not only contributes to reduced weight and improved efficiency but also aligns with the growing trend of automating vehicle systems to improve safety and user experience.


Moreover, electric drum brakes are gradually finding their way into industrial applications, such as in forklifts and other material handling equipment, where reliability and ease of operation are paramount.
